In this performance comparison, the Realme 12 Pro+ with its Qualcomm Snapdragon 7s Gen 2 (4nm) performs better than the Redmi Note 13 with the Mediatek Dimensity 6080 (6nm), thanks to superior chipset efficiency.
Realme 12 Pro+ launched with Android 14 and will receive updates until Android 17, whereas Redmi Note 13 launched with Android 13 and will get Android 16. Both phones are expected to receive security updates until around 2028.
Both Realme 12 Pro+ and Redmi Note 13 feature AMOLED displays, offering vibrant colors and deeper blacks. Both smartphones offer the same 120 Hz refresh rate. Redmi Note 13 also boasts a brighter screen with 1000 nits of peak brightness, enhancing outdoor visibility. Both phones have the same screen resolution.
Both phones are equipped with the same 5000 mAh battery capacity. Realme 12 Pro+ also supports faster wired charging at 67W, compared to 33W on Redmi Note 13.
Realme 12 Pro+ offers better protection against water and dust with an IP65 rating.
